India, China ink pacts on water resources, culture





India and China signed two agreements including one in the field of water resources on sharing hydrological data on Satluj river after talks between Vice President Hamid Ansari and his Chinese counterpart Li Yuanchao. Li is the first Chinese  Vice president who visited India.

In Aurangabad, the Chinese Vice President visited the Ajanta Caves and also met the city mayor.
In Kolkata, he met West Bengal Governor Keshari Nath Tripathi and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ee. He also visited Jorasanko Thakur Bari, the ancestral home of Rabindranath Tagore which is now part of Rabindra Bharati University campus.

The pact in water resources was renewal of an agreement dealing with sharing hydrological data on Satluj, under the cultural pact, India will hold exhibition of art from the Gupta period, which was known as “golden period” in the country.
